Understanding Heaving and Settlement
Heaving occurs when a slab rises, often due to expanding clay soils, freezing conditions, or invasive tree roots. Settlement is the opposite: the slab sinks, commonly because of soil compaction, erosion, or improper site preparation. Both problems can lead to trip hazards, water drainage issues, and further structural problems if not addressed.
Common Causes in Oregon
- Clay-rich soils: Many regions of the Willamette Valley have expansive clays that swell with moisture and shrink during dry spells, causing slabs to shift.
- Freeze-thaw cycles: While western Oregon has a mild climate, cold snaps and wet winters can still cause frost heave in poorly drained soils or in higher elevations.
- Tree roots: Fast-growing tree roots can push up slabs, especially in older neighborhoods with mature landscaping.
- Poor drainage: Heavy rain and inadequate run-off management can wash away or saturate soils under slabs, leading to uneven settling.
Fixing Settled and Heaved Slabs: Options and Tradeoffs
The right repair method depends on the extent of the movement, your budget, and how you use the slab. Here are the most common approaches used in Oregon:
Slab Jacking (Mudjacking or Polyjacking)
- How it works: Small holes are drilled in the slab, and grout or polyurethane foam is pumped underneath to raise and support the concrete.
- Best for: Sunken driveways, sidewalks, and patios with minor to moderate settlement where the slab is still largely intact.
- Pros: Less expensive and faster than replacement; minimal disruption.
- Cons: Not effective if the slab is severely cracked, broken, or heaving due to roots or frost.
Slab Replacement
- How it works: The old slab is broken up and removed. The subgrade is re-prepared, and new concrete is poured.
- Best for: Severe heaving or settlement, chronic root intrusion, or when the slab is too damaged for jacking.
- Pros: A chance to address soil or drainage problems and redesign slab thickness or reinforcement.
- Cons: More costly and time-consuming; may require permits and landscape repair afterward.
Root and Drainage Corrections
- Tree root removal: For heaving caused by roots, a trench may be dug next to the slab to cut or install a barrier to prevent further intrusion. Consult an arborist before cutting roots near mature trees to avoid tree decline.
- Drainage improvements: Redirecting downspouts, adding drains, or regrading soil can prevent future settlement due to water issues.
DIY or Hire a Contractor?
Small repairs—such as filling minor cracks or improving drainage—are often reasonable for experienced DIYers. However, slab jacking and replacement require specialized equipment and knowledge of soil conditions. For most homeowners, hiring a contractor is safer and delivers better long-term results, especially for structural slabs or areas with significant movement.
Signs You Need a Pro
- Slab has moved more than 1 inch vertically
- Cracks are wider than 1/4 inch or run through the full thickness
- Evidence of poor soil or drainage under the slab
- Tree roots are involved, or you’re near utilities
Common Mistakes to Avoid
- Ignoring underlying causes: Simply patching the concrete without correcting drainage or root problems often leads to repeat issues.
- Poor quality fill material: Using loose soil or un-compacted gravel under a new slab can contribute to future settlement.
- Overlooking permits or property lines: While minor repairs rarely require permits, significant regrading or new slabs near property lines might. Always check before starting work.
- DIY slab jacking with unsuitable materials: Injecting the wrong type of grout or foam, or applying uneven pressure, can crack the slab or make the problem worse.
